Bill Summary

Establishes appropriate sanctions for the offense of assault against a law enforcement officer in the first degree.

AI Summary

This bill amends existing law to establish more severe penalties for assaulting a law enforcement officer in the first degree, which is defined as intentionally or knowingly causing bodily injury to an officer on duty, or recklessly causing bodily injury with a dangerous instrument, or recklessly causing serious or substantial bodily injury to an officer on duty. The bill increases the minimum mandatory jail time for this offense from thirty days to six months, and for cases involving serious or substantial bodily injury, the minimum mandatory jail time will be one year without the possibility of suspension. These changes are intended to address the increasing dangers faced by law enforcement officers and to deter future assaults.
